John Hornak is a composer, engineer and guitarist exploring the genre’s of Dub and Ambient. Creating and programming custom synthesizers and instruments to achive a unique tone and sound inspired by the early Dub pioneers (King Tubby, Jackie Mittoo, Lee “Scratch” Perry). Working as a recording engineer and producer for the past 15 years. John forged his skills working with some of Canada’s top talent, including Brendan Mcguire (Sloan, Feist), Ras Bagel (Jackie Mittoo) and Ellis Hall (E3, Redman)

“Songs Carved Of Wood”, was Hornak’s first solo album. Started in 2004 the record was eventually completed 4 years later. The sessions were recorded in Toronto, Montreal and Ottawa ending with a pilgrimage to western Canada. Songs Carved Of Wood is divided in four parts Seed, Sprout, Driftwood and Boreal. The exposition of a single idea, encompassing acoustic and synthesized styles ranging from folk to dub. It was released exclusively online at woodsongs.ca on January 10 2008 and has been downloaded thousands of times, in countries all over the world.

A Needle, A Feather And A Rope, The latest album by John Hornak, is a recollection of his travels in sound. From Prague, John journeyed through Eastern Europe, Morocco and Spain, constantly recording and composing small melodies.

The opening track (Hlavna Stanica) is an ode to Bratislava played on solo piano. “Jemma El Fna”, track 6, is an aural memory of the famous Moroccan Market.
